Michael J Minitor was born and raised in Washington, DC by his Irish immigrant parents, Samuel McCardel and Mary Jane Ellison. By the age of 18 he worked in Baltimore as a moulder and lived with his widowed mother. He enlisted in the U.S. Marine Corps 1 Aug 1896, and was stationed on the USS Marblehead in Hampton Roads, Virginia six months later.
In 1897 Michael married Catherine Cress. Together they had eight children. The 1900 census lists the first two children and niece Honora Minitor in the Baltimore household supported by Michael's work as a molder in a foundry. The 1920 census shows two of their children have died, but six remain at home; niece Honora is not listed. Michael's wife died the same year.
The 1930 census shows that Michael now works as a real estate broker and lives with his second wife, Catherine Schroen Dettmer, and two step-children.
When Michael died in 1935 he was buried next to his first wife in Section SS, Lot 433 in New Cathedral Cemetery in Baltimore. His second wife died five years later.
